新闻动态

良好的口碑是企业发展的动力

网站建设和网站开发有什么区别?详细对比解读

发布时间:2025-07-27 08:19:25 点击量:21
模板网站

 

网站建设与网站开发的详细对比解读

在互联网时代,网站已成为企业、组织和个人展示形象、提供服务的重要工具。然而,对于非技术背景的人来说,网站建设和网站开发这两个概念常常被混淆。尽管两者密切相关,但它们在实际操作中有着明显的区别。本文将从定义、流程、技术、工具、目标等多个维度对网站建设与网站开发进行详细对比,帮助读者更好地理解两者的异同。


一、定义与核心概念

  1. 网站建设
    网站建设(Website Construction)是一个相对宽泛的概念,指的是从零开始创建一个网站的全过程。它涵盖了从策划、设计到上线运营的多个环节,重点在于网站的整体构建和用户体验。网站建设通常包括以下内容:

    • 网站策划:确定网站的目标、受众、功能需求等。
    • 网站设计:包括视觉设计(UI)和用户体验设计(UX)。
    • 内容填充:撰写文案、上传图片、视频等。
    • 网站部署:将网站发布到服务器并上线。
    • 后续维护:更新内容、优化性能等。

    网站建设更注重网站的整体性和可访问性,通常使用现成的工具或平台(如WordPress、Wix)来实现,适合非技术背景的用户。

  2. 网站开发
    网站开发(Website Development)则是一个技术性更强的过程,专注于网站的功能实现和后台逻辑。它涉及编写代码、构建数据库、开发功能模块等技术工作。网站开发通常分为前端开发和后端开发:

    • 前端开发:负责网站的界面设计和用户交互,使用HTML、CSS、JavaScript等技术。
    • 后端开发:负责服务器端逻辑、数据库管理和功能实现,使用PHP、Python、Java等编程语言。

    网站开发更注重技术实现和功能扩展,通常由专业的开发人员完成,适合需要定制化功能或复杂逻辑的网站。


二、流程对比

  1. 网站建设的流程

    • 需求分析:明确网站的目标、受众和功能需求。
    • 设计与布局:使用设计工具(如Figma、Photoshop)创建网站的视觉稿。
    • 选择平台:选择合适的建站工具(如WordPress、Squarespace)。
    • 内容填充:添加文案、图片、视频等内容。
    • 测试与上线:检查网站的功能和兼容性,然后发布到服务器。
    • 维护与优化:定期更新内容,优化用户体验。
  2. 网站开发的流程

    • 需求分析:与客户沟通,明确功能需求和开发目标。
    • 技术选型:选择合适的技术栈(如React、Node.js)。
    • 前端开发:编写HTML、CSS、JavaScript代码,实现界面和交互。
    • 后端开发:编写服务器端代码,构建数据库和功能逻辑。
    • 测试与调试:进行功能测试、性能测试和兼容性测试。
    • 部署与上线:将代码部署到服务器,配置域名和SSL证书。
    • 维护与迭代:修复漏洞,优化性能,添加新功能。

三、技术与工具对比

  1. 网站建设的技术与工具

    • 建站平台:WordPress、Wix、Squarespace等。
    • 设计工具:Figma、Adobe XD、Photoshop等。
    • 内容管理系统(CMS):用于管理网站内容,如WordPress、Joomla。
    • 插件与模板:通过现成的插件和模板快速实现功能。
  2. 网站开发的技术与工具

    • 前端技术:HTML、CSS、JavaScript、React、Vue.js等。
    • 后端技术:PHP、Python、Java、Node.js等。
    • 数据库:MySQL、PostgreSQL、MongoDB等。
    • 开发工具:VS Code、Git、Webpack等。
    • 框架与库:Express、Django、Laravel等。

四、目标与适用场景

  1. 网站建设的目标

    • 快速搭建一个功能齐全、外观美观的网站。
    • 适用于中小型企业、个人博客、展示型网站等。
    • 强调用户体验和内容展示,而非复杂功能。
  2. 网站开发的目标

    • 实现定制化的功能和复杂的逻辑。
    • 适用于电商平台、社交网络、企业管理系统等。
    • 强调技术实现和功能扩展,满足特定业务需求。

五、成本与时间对比

  1. 网站建设的成本与时间

    • 成本:较低,通常只需支付建站平台费用和设计费用。
    • 时间:较短,使用现成的模板和工具可以快速完成。
  2. 网站开发的成本与时间

    • 成本:较高,需要支付开发人员的人工费用和技术支持费用。
    • 时间:较长,从需求分析到功能实现需要较长时间。

六、人员要求对比

  1. 网站建设的人员要求

    • 需要具备一定的设计能力和内容管理能力。
    • 无需编程知识,但需要熟悉建站平台的操作。
  2. 网站开发的人员要求

    • 需要具备扎实的编程能力和技术背景。
    • 通常需要前端开发人员、后端开发人员和测试人员共同协作。

七、优缺点对比

  1. 网站建设的优缺点

    • 优点:成本低、速度快、操作简单。
    • 缺点:功能受限、可扩展性差、难以实现复杂需求。
  2. 网站开发的优缺点

    • 优点:功能强大、可定制化、扩展性好。
    • 缺点:成本高、耗时长、技术要求高。

八、总结

网站建设和网站开发虽然目标都是创建一个网站,但它们在流程、技术、成本和适用场景上有着显著的区别。网站建设更适合那些需要快速搭建简单网站的用户,而网站开发则适合需要实现复杂功能和定制化需求的用户。理解两者的区别,可以帮助用户根据自身需求选择合适的方式,从而更高效地完成网站创建任务。

免责声明:本文内容由互联网用户自发贡献自行上传,本网站不拥有所有权,也不承认相关法律责任。如果您发现本社区中有涉嫌抄袭的内容,请发送邮件至:dm@cn86.cn进行举报,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权内容。本站原创内容未经允许不得转载。